Mongolian grill to open at former Hardee’s site in Loves Park

LOVES PARK, Ill. (WTVO) — A new Mongolian grill is planning to move into the former Hardee’s location in Loves Park.

Super Bowl Mongolian Grill is expected to move into the space at 1550 E. Riverside Blvd, according to the City of Loves Park.

Mongolian grill-style restaurants offer Asian-fusion stir-fry cuisine.

Rockford was once home to a BD’s Mongolian Grill location at 7310 Walton Street, but it closed in 2010.

Nearby, a new Mexican restaurant, Tacos El Jefe Mexican Grill, is expected to open in the former Fuji Cancun building at 6566 E. Riverside.

And, the city announced that Tahini’s, which will offer Middle Eastern cuisine, will open at Loves Park Crossings at 1521 E. Riverside Blvd.

No opening dates were announced.
